Pakistan's FM, Norwegian counterpart discuss bilateral, regional matters

Islamabad (UNA) – Pakistani Foreign Minister Shah Mahmood Qureshi on Thursday discussed over the phone with his Norwegian counterpart Ine Marie Eriksen Søreide, bilateral, regional and international matters including Afghanistan and COVID-19 situation.

The two foreign ministers exchanged views on enhancing cooperation in diverse sectors such as trade, investment and clean energy.

Qureshi appreciated the growing business relations between Pakistan and Norway and expressed satisfaction at Norwegian investment in Pakistan.

For her part, Foreign Minister Søreide appreciated the role of the Government of Pakistan in facilitating the signing of the solar power project between Scatec and Nizam Energy. She also lauded the constructive role of Norwegians of Pakistani origin in the economic development of Norway.
